4-AP Peripheral Nerve Crossover Trial

NCT06003166 · Status: RECRUITING · Phase: PHASE2 · Type: INTERVENTIONAL · Enrollment: 68

Last updated 2025-08-05

No results posted yet for this study

Summary

The purpose of this study is to evaluate the role of single dose 4-aminopyridine (4-AP) on the diagnosis of severing vs non-severing nerve injury after peripheral nerve traction and/or crush injury. The investigational treatment will be used to test the hypothesis that 4-aminopyridine can speed the determination of nerve continuity after peripheral nerve traction and/or crush injuries allowing the identification of incomplete injuries earlier than standard electrodiagnostic (EDX) and clinical assessment.

Participants will be randomized to one of two groups to determine the order of treatment they receive (drug and placebo vs placebo and drug). Participants will undergo baseline testing for nerve assessment, receive either drug or placebo based on randomization and undergo hourly sensory and motor evaluation, EDX testing and serum 4AP levels for three hours after dosing. Participants will then repeat this with the crossover arm.

Interventions

DRUG

4-Aminopyridine

Study drug will be a one time, 10mg dose of 4-aminopyridine

OTHER

Placebo

Matched placebo
